This invite-only, two-day workshop, hosted by the Orange County Water District, is jointly organized by the State Water Resources Control Board (SWB) and The Water Research Foundation (WRF). The event brings together utilities, researchers, and partners to identify and prioritize research concepts for funding under SWB Grant 3.
Workshop Goals:
- Review state of science of potable and nonpotable reuse in CA.
- Identify biggest research gaps to accelerate implementation of reuse.
- Develop the research agenda and prioritize projects valued at $1.5M.
